A Sense of Relief
What fear absorb the world when much of the story is untold, what fear absorb the world when the miracle is yet to unfold. The secret ballot is already unleashed and the people began to cross the street, the doors are open wide and symphony has brought the whole world alive. Business is up and running and the mills are grinding. Everyone is already in their rightful place getting ready for the big race. The cars are on the assemble line and the semi-conductors have flown in just in time. The breaks are on the lever and everyone is caught up in this irresistible fever. It is strange but it gets the people through the terrible atmosphere. Idle hands lay about the street looking for something to eat; a day’s work or night out will put them in line to coordinate with the time. Something’s are short-term others are permanents but anything will do until they get through. Fifteen pounds a day will keep hunger away and twenty dollars a day will chase the bay lift away. You can’t imagine the sacrifice the people have made just to keep their sanity in place. They roll the dice on blank paper and scrape the dredges from the bottom of well and the place the pillow in the middle of their bed to marks their sincerity. I looked beyond the sun and saw destiny on the run, and a strange heat with flickering light descend on the earth in broad daylight. You chase up and down the street masquerading in the mayor’s shoes eating caviar in the governor’s mansion and shaking your legs with a stick in the bed. The moment passes quickly and the earth reveals its beauty, beautiful women dressed in skinny jeans and miniskirts and a rose stick to the side of their hair entertain the crowd and teach them what justice is all about. It parades through the street disrupting the people’s heart beat. All the so called assassinators and self-appointed Prime-Ministers have sustained a self-inflected wound and their bodies will wash up at the shore at noon and everyone will have eternal peace. The Prime-Ministers will be replaced by the rainbow colors and new ambassadors to restore order to the town. You must set up a special Easter market and fill it with lots of goodies and get the people to shop. Just as I speak of it, the entertainers are out in full numbers. They took to the stage gathering large crowds around them, celebrities all standing in line getting ready for the gigantic parade. The festival is on the road again and bright lights are shining in the streets and the people are enjoying the treat, and everyone is breathing sense of relief.
